Abstract
Weak power supply networks are very sensitive to non-linear low power loads. Electronics in low power loads are non-linear, very basic, and consisting of a rectifier bridge and
bulk capacitor, consuming current only in the peak of the
supplied voltage. Due to the relative high power supply network impedance the waveform of the supplied voltage is heavily distorted. In this paper the effect of energy saving lights on a mobile generator, simulating a weak grid, is studied.
